要点与 教程库

Div*_*dev 19 gist github

我正在发布一个教程,其中包含大量代码,其中散布着文档.我正在考虑两种托管代码的方式:

  1. 将git存储库与解释代码的代码文件和markdown文件分开
  2. Github要点包含这两个

在gist v/sa存储库中托管是否有优势?什么时候会更喜欢其中一个而不是另一个呢?

小智 23

Gist是一种与其他人共享片段和粘贴的简单方法.而Repo只是存储工作历史的地方.

没有好的答案,这是个人喜好.我认为这是一个概念上的区别.如果它的代码旨在演示技术,教授原则,或展示解决方案,那么它就是一个要点.如果它是一个文件或30个文件无关紧要.如果它是用于运行的实际代码,按原样使用,或者作为样板分叉,我将它放在适当的存储库中.

  • "如果它是一个文件或30个文件并不重要"......但是如果你需要子目录那么重要.Gist不支持目录. (19认同)